Kaytania Posted October 3, 2004 Report Share Posted October 3, 2004 My convicts have been destroying my layout of the tank for the last week or 2 and I now know why. They have been getting ready to spawn and I just found out that I have convict fry in the tank now. I was trying to clean the tank a little and she kept on attacking my hand and the equipment. I thought that she was just moody and then I talked to Travis and we found out that there or fry in there. I was just getting ready to move them from their temp tank to a larger tank over the next couple of weeks, but now I will have to wait a few more weeks to do that. Kaytania Posted December 31, 2004 Author Report Share Posted December 31, 2004 Hey, Sorry I haven't posted in a while, was having computer problems. Here is an update; from my first spawn I have 3 babies that survived. I am now on my second spawn and so far I have a lot more at this point then at the same point of my first spawn. I have the 3 from the first spawn seperated into a 10 gallon they are between 1 and 1.5 inches. My babies from the second spawn are roughly .5 of an inch. I will try to keep you updated.
